News

Teaching math with computer programming – either as part of a standard math course or as an elective – can give mathematical concepts context and relevance while still requiring the same amount of ...
Overview Begin your journey with artificial intelligence programming using Python and other beginner-friendly languages.Hands ...
One of the most common questions I get from teachers and parents is: What programming language should we use to teach kids to code? Is it important to always start with block-based languages like ...
Teaching STEM and Programming—No Experience Needed By Alexander Kmicikewycz — January 11, 2018 8 min read Alexander Kmicikewycz Contributor ...
A local high school student has cracked the code on reaching underserved elementary school students through his own nonprofit called "canCode," which uses teenage volunteers to teach the basics of ...
Translating these real-world motivations for understanding concurrency and parallelism isn’t abstract. It’s real. When teaching programming, “think parallel” should come very early on.
Dear Everyone Teaching Programming: You’re Doing It Wrong If we want to bring coding skills to the masses, we may have to reinvent what programming is.